Starlink Speed Update
We are at the Rock Springs/Green River KOA in Rock Springs Wyoming this morning. Our Starlink speed is 170mbps down and 60mbps up.

Centennial RV Park in Montrose, CO. 6:50 AM
Starlink: 178 Down & 15 Up using the Starlink App and 169 Down and 14 Up using the Speedtest app.
For comparison sake,
T-Mobile Home: 437 Down and 76.4 Up using Speedtest app. Impressive.
Verizon: (wifi turned off on the cell) 9.47 Down and 23.5 Up using Speedtest app.
All tests were done using my Samsung Galaxy S22 Ultra cell phone.

Most of the time I get the same result both in the campground and while traveling down the road with T-Mobile being faster than Starlink. I use Caylx for going on three years without a problem for less than 43.00 per month. If I don't have a usable T-Mobile connection I can break out the Starlink. When I get to the campgrounds I check T-Mobile and if I have a good signal I don't have to worry about parking under trees and I can enjoy the shade.
I have the same results with Verion as you also. Most of the place I have been AT&T and T-Mobile has been a lot faster than Verizon.

My Starlink speed changes minute to minute. It can be 2 mbps then a minute later it is 200. Then occasionally the internet will go out completely for a minute or 2. I think that is when it is switching from one satellite to another. It can't lock onto a satellite for long before it moves out of range, then the antenna searches for another one.

I've never seen mine work like that unless the dish is blocked, even just on an edge. Have you checked the app for any blockages? What about outages, they track those too.
For me, using Starlink is like having a cable modem, not the fastest cable modem, but a steady bandwidth that I can literally swap from a cable modem to Starlink and notice no difference (at say 100mb down/20 up).
Just tested my speed in CT, 116 down, 15 up.

We have Starlink Best Effort plan at our house in western Louisiana, lately we have been seeing speeds of around 65 mbps down and 12-15 mbps up most of the time, which is better than when we first got Starlink about 8 months ago. By comparison our AT&T Hotspot we use while traveling rarely gets more than 5 mbps at our house during the daylight hours (over saturated tower is my guess), as we saw speeds of over 50 mbps with it on our recent trip to South Dakota.
